Key vote held on Keystone XL pipeline

The U.S. House of Representatives has voted in favor of constructing the Keystone XL pipeline, which would carry crude oil from Canada to American refineries.

Environmentalists oppose the Keystone XL pipeline, and some First Nations / Native American groups do not want the pipeline to cross their reservations, while the energy sector says it will create thousands of new jobs and keep energy prices low.

The U.S. State Department would only say that its review of the proposed pipeline and its impact is ongoing, referring any further questions to the White House.
